Based on previous studies, researchers believe that 5% of children are born with a gene that is linked to a certain childhood disease. If the researchers test 1500 newborns for the presence of this gene, would it be unlikely for them to find fewer than 65 children with the gene? Calculate the z-score and base your response upon the z-score.
